The Office of Developmental Programs (ODP) contracts with Temple University Harrisburg to deliver the ODP Certified Investigator (CI) Program. ODP and Temple University have developed a new lesson that, in addition to the exam, must be completed as part of the recertification process.

The new lesson is called “Recertification Review: The Certified Investigator’s Role in the Investigative Process.” This lesson will provide an overview of the investigation process as well as cover anything that has changed in the CI Manual since the CI’s last certification. This new requirement is effective beginning with May 2025 recertifications.

Additionally, there will be some timeframe changes to when the recertification exam is available, beginning with May 2025 recertifications.

ODP Announcement 22-056 is to communicate that registration for the July – December 2022 Certified Investigator (CI) Initial Certification Course classes (also known as cohorts) is now open on MyODP. The Initial CI Certification Course was created to ensure that all incidents requiring an investigation receive a systematic review that meets established standards. In order to perform investigations, the investigator must successfully complete all requirements of the CI Initial Certification Course.

Due to continued concerns regarding COVID-19, the July – December 2022 CI Initial Certification cohorts of the course will be provided virtually rather than in person.
